World Bank: Remittance Flows Set To Drop $100 Billion From Pandemic

PYMNTS

The world remittance fall-off anticipated because of the coronavirus pandemic could have serious effects for numerous countries, according to a Financial Times report that cited the World Bank. The World Bank estimates that there were 272 million migrant workers working internationally, refugees included, in 2019.
